The problem
Report the total value invested in 2016 by the policyholders who share their 2015 investment value with at least one other policyholder and whose city is shared with nobody, rounded to two decimals. Two policyholders sit in the same city when their latitude and longitude are identical. The Insurance table has one row per policy: pid (int, the primary key), tiv_2015 (float, the total investment value in 2015), tiv_2016 (float, the total investment value in 2016), and lat and lon (float, the latitude and longitude of the policyholder's city, never null).
Example
Insurance table: | pid | tiv_2015 | tiv_2016 | lat | lon | | --- | -------- | -------- | ---- | ---- | | 1 | 45.00 | 120.25 | 12.0 | 8.0 | | 2 | 45.00 | 90.00 | 31.0 | 44.0 | | 3 | 45.00 | 75.00 | 31.0 | 44.0 | | 4 | 60.00 | 200.30 | 55.0 | 12.0 | | 5 | 60.00 | 150.00 | 70.0 | 25.0 | Result: | tiv_2016 | | -------- | | 470.55 | Policies 1, 4 and 5 each share their tiv_2015 with someone else and each sit at a location nobody else shares, so their 2016 values add up to 470.55; policies 2 and 3 share the location (31.0, 44.0) and drop out.
Python solution
import pandas as pd
def investments_2016(insurance: pd.DataFrame) -> pd.DataFrame:
tiv_count = insurance.groupby('tiv_2015')['pid'].transform('count')
loc_count = insurance.groupby(['lat', 'lon'])['pid'].transform('count')
filt = (tiv_count > 1) & (loc_count == 1)
total = insurance.loc[filt, 'tiv_2016'].sum()
return pd.DataFrame({'tiv_2016': [round(float(total), 2)]})Complexity
| Measure | Complexity |
|---|---|
| Time | O(n log n) (typical) |
| Space | O(n) auxiliary |
